St. Elizabeth's, Boston, MA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in St. Elizabeth's?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| St. Elizabeth's Studio Apartments | $2,569 | $1,700 | $5,650 |
| St. Elizabeth's 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,781 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| St. Elizabeth's 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,399 | $375 | $10,000+ |
| St. Elizabeth's 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,933 | $2,550 | $10,000+ |
| St. Elizabeth's 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,890 | $1,225 | $10,000+ |
| St. Elizabeth's 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,928 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
| St. Elizabeth's 6 Bedroom Apartments | $8,713 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
